First, the section chiefs for waste reduction, cleaning, and garbage disposal under the Mito Municipal Living Environment Department talked about waste classification methods, inspirations to the citizens, waste collection methods, and the basics about a local waste incineration plant.
Then, the counterpart officials from Chongqing's Jiulongpo district, Tongliang district, and Chengkou county talked about their own waste classification and treatment methods and related issues.
A question & answer session was also set up near the end of the video conference, where representatives from each side gave detailed explanations and recommended solutions to questions raised by the other side.
